Middle East and Africa Stretchable and Conformal Electronics Market Trends

Printed, Skin-Conformal and High-Strain Electronics Accelerate Commercialization

Development is shifting from mechanically flexible devices toward intrinsically stretchable architectures capable of maintaining electrical performance under repeated deformation. In 2025, researchers demonstrated stretchable organic-transistor platforms exceeding 50% elongation, while direct-ink-written capacitive sensors demonstrated stretchability of up to 550%, an R² of 0.99 and hysteresis of 1.36%. Such improvements support wearable healthcare, electronic skin, robotics and continuous physiological sensing.

Display engineering is progressing simultaneously. A 2025 demonstration achieved controlled deformation of a 7×7 stretchable display array at strains reaching 200%, while LG Display's earlier prototype expanded from 12 inches to 18 inches, corresponding to 50% elongation, with 100-PPI resolution and durability exceeding 10,000 stretching cycles. These advances are moving stretchable electronics toward smart apparel, vehicle surfaces and human-machine interfaces.

Middle East and Africa Stretchable and Conformal Electronics Market Drivers

Wearable Healthcare and Continuous Biosignal Monitoring Accelerate Adoption

Healthcare digitization is increasing requirements for skin-compatible sensors capable of capturing ECG, EMG, EEG, strain and pressure signals without rigid form factors. Stretchable organic electronics have demonstrated elongation above 50%, while self-powered triboelectric sensors have reported 122 V open-circuit voltage, 25 μA short-circuit current and stability through 40,000 mechanical cycles. These performance thresholds strengthen the commercial case for continuous monitoring, rehabilitation and personalized healthcare systems.

Middle East and Africa Stretchable and Conformal Electronics Market Restraints

Durability, Integration Complexity and Manufacturing Yield Restrict Scale-Up

Commercialization remains constrained by mechanical fatigue, encapsulation, interconnect reliability and integration of power, sensing and processing components. Laboratory devices can achieve 550% strain or operate for tens of thousands of cycles, yet translating these specifications into high-yield production remains difficult. Recent literature continues to identify reliability, device integration and memory architecture as barriers to printed and flexible electronics, particularly when low-cost manufacturing and high electrical performance must be achieved simultaneously.

Middle East and Africa Stretchable and Conformal Electronics Market Opportunities

Smart Textiles, Soft Robotics and Automotive Surfaces Expand Addressable Applications

Emerging manufacturing processes create opportunities to embed electronics directly into garments and deformable surfaces. A 2026 textile-compatible sensor demonstrated 120% stretchability, approximately linear response through 60% strain with R² of 0.99, a gauge factor of 31.4 and baseline drift of 0.135% per cycle. These capabilities support sports garments, rehabilitation devices, robotic skins and automotive interfaces where conventional rigid circuitry cannot accommodate continuous deformation.

Challenges in Middle East and Africa Stretchable and Conformal Electronics Market

Material Compatibility and Repeatable High-Volume Fabrication Remain Technical Bottlenecks

Stretchable systems require simultaneous optimization of conductivity, elasticity, adhesion, biocompatibility and environmental stability. Performance demonstrated at 50%, 120%, 200% or even 550% strain does not automatically translate into commercial reliability across millions of products. Research consequently emphasizes durable encapsulation, hybrid integration and scalable manufacturing, while self-healing sensor development is addressing device damage and shortened operating life.

Recent Developments in Middle East and Africa Stretchable and Conformal Electronics Market

  • 2026:Research on textile-integrated direct-ink-written sensors demonstrated 120% stretchability, R² of 0.99 through approximately 60% strain and a gauge factor of 31.4.
  • 2026:A review of smart wearable and implantable biosensors highlighted continuous real-time monitoring and AI integration as major directions for personalized healthcare electronics.
  • 2025:POSTECH researchers reported a 7×7 intrinsically stretchable display architecture capable of controlled deformation reaching 200%.
  • 2025:Stretchable organic-transistor research demonstrated wearable in-sensor computing with elongation exceeding 50% while maintaining operational performance.
  • 2025:Research into recyclable, self-healing liquid-metal strain sensors addressed durability and repairability limitations affecting wearable and soft-robotic electronics.
